The IEEE International Symposium on Computational Intelligence
in Biometrics and Identity Management (CIBIM 2019) will be held within
the 2019 IEEE Symposium Series on Computational Intelligence (IEEE SSCI
2019) in a beautiful port city - Xiamen, China.
The main objective of
CIBIM 2019 is to bring researchers from academia and industry together
to exchange the latest theoretical and experimental CI solutions in
biometrics and identity management. This event will provide an
interdisciplinary forum for researchers, developers and practitioner
especially in the CI field to present state of the art biometric
research and technology, as well as the potential problems in real
applications.
